Definitions

There is 1 meaning of the phrase Sneak Away.

Sneak Away - as a verb

Leave furtively and stealthily

Example: "The lecture was boring and many students slipped out when the instructor turned towards the blackboard"

Example Sentences

"I tried to sneak away from the party unnoticed."
"She would often sneak away from work to go shopping."
"The cat managed to sneak away with a piece of chicken from the table."
"We decided to sneak away early from the boring lecture."
"The children giggled as they tried to sneak away from their parents."
